File: /home/undanet/dump/data/PortalEmpleo/src/Views/DetalleConvocatoriaView.php
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<title>Gestión de Convocatorias</title>
<script src="https://ajax.googleapis.com/ajax/libs/angularjs/1.6.9/angular.min.js"></script>
<?php
$_SERVER['HTTPS'] = $_SERVER['HTTPS'] == 'off' ? '' : $_SERVER['HTTPS'];
$root = (!empty($_SERVER['HTTPS']) ? 'https' : 'http') . '://' . $_SERVER['HTTP_HOST'] . '/';
$rootwp = "";
$actual_link = (isset($_SERVER['HTTPS']) && $_SERVER['HTTPS'] === 'on' ? "https" : "http") . "://$_SERVER[HTTP_HOST]$_SERVER[REQUEST_URI]";
$lang = 'es';
if(isset($_GET['lang']))
{
switch($_GET['lang'])
{
case 'en':
case 'en_GB':
$lang = 'en';
break;
default:
$lang = 'es';
break;
}
}
$idCandidatoWP = $data['candidatoWP'];
$data = $data['convocatoria'];
const CODIGO_ESTADO_ABIERTA = 1;
?>
</head>
<body>
<div class="wrap-content" ng-app="">
<table border="0">
<tbody>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="txtReferencia">Reference:</label></td>';
}
else
{
echo '<label for="txtReferencia">Referencia:</label></td>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tReferencia" id="txtReferencia" value="' . $data->getReferencia() . '" disabled>';
}
else
{
echo '<input type="text" name="txtReferencia" id="txtReferencia" disabled>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="txtDescripcion">Description:</label></td>';
}
else
{
echo '<label for="txtDescripcion">Descripción:</label></td>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tDescripcion" id="txtDescripcion" value="' . $data->getDescripcion() . '" disabled>';
}
else
{
echo '<input type="text" name="txtDescripcion" id="txtDescripcion" disabled>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="txtPuestoTrabajo">Job:</label>';
}
else
{
echo '<label for="txtPuestoTrabajo">Puesto Trabajo: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tPuestoTrabajo" id="txtPuestoTrabajo" value="' . $data->getPuestoTrabajo() . '" disabled>';
}
else
{
echo '<input type="text" name="txtPuestoTrabajo" id="txtPuestoTrabajo" disabled>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="txtCentro">Center:</label>';
}
else
{
echo '<label for="txtCentro">Centro: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tCentro" id="txtCentro" value="' . $data->getCentro() . '" disabled>';
}
else
{
echo '<input type="text" name="txtCentro" id="txtCentro" disabled>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="dtFechaInicio">Start Date:</label>';
}
else
{
echo '<label for="dtFechaInicio">Fecha Inicio: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="hidden" name="dtFechaInicio" id="dtFechaInicio" value="' .
$data->getFechaInicio()->format('Y-m-d') . '" required>';
echo '<input type="date" name="dtFechaInicio" id="dtFechaInicio" value="' .
$data->getFechaInicio()->format('Y-m-d') . '" disabled="true">';
}
else
{
echo '<input type="date" name="dtFechaInicio" id="dtFechaInicio" value="'. date("d-m-Y\TH-i") . '">';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="dtFechaFin">End Date:</label>';
}
else
{
echo '<label for="dtFechaFin">Fecha Fin: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
if($data->getFechaFin()->format('Y-m-d')<date("Y-m-d"))
{
echo '<input type="hidden" name="dtFechaFin" id="dtFechaFin" value="' .
$data->getFechaFin()->format('Y-m-d') . '" required>';
}
echo '<input type="date" name="dtFechaFin" id="dtFechaFin" value="' .
$data->getFechaFin()->format('Y-m-d') . '"';
echo ' disabled>';
}
else
{
echo '<input type="date" name="dtFechaFin" id="dtFechaFin" value="'. date("d-m-Y\TH-i") . '" disabled>';
}
echo '<input type="date" name="dtFechaUltimaActualizacion" id="dtFechaUltimaActualizacion" value="'. date("Y-m-d") . '" hidden="true" disabled>';
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="flPDFConvocatoria">Call PDF:</label>';
}
else
{
echo '<label for="flPDFConvocatoria">PDF Convocatoria: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
//echo '<a href="' . $data->getRutaarchivoconvocatoria() . '" target="_blank">' . $data->getRutaarchivoconvocatoria() . '</a>';
echo '<a href="' . $root . 'descargaC/?ref=' . $data->getReferencia() . '&file=' . basename($data->getRutaarchivoconvocatoria()) . '" target="_blank">' . basename($data->getRutaarchivoconvocatoria()) . '</a>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="flPDFResolucionFinal">End Resolution PDF:</label>';
}
else
{
echo '<label for="flPDFResolucionFinal">PDF Resolución Final: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
//echo '<a href="' . $data->getRutaarchivoresolucionfinal() . '" target="_blank">' . $data->getRutaarchivoresolucionfinal() . '</a>';
echo '<a href="' . $root . 'descargaC/?ref=' . $data->getReferencia() . '&file=' . basename($data->getRutaarchivoresolucionfinal()) . '" target="_blank">' . basename($data->getRutaarchivoresolucionfinal()) . '</a>';
}
?>
</td>
</tr>
</tr>
<tr>
<td><label for="txtWeb">Web:</label></td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tWeb" id="txtWeb" value="' . $data->getUrlweb() . '" disabled>';
}
else
{
echo '<input type="text" name="txtWeb" id="txtWeb" disabled>';
}
?>
</td>
</tr>
<tr>
<td>
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<label for="slctEstado">State:</label>';
}
else
{
echo '<label for="slctEstado">Estado:</label>';
}
?>
</td>
<td>
<?php
if(isset($data) && is_object($data))
{
echo '<input type="text" name="txtEstado" id="txtEstado" value="' . ($data->getCodigoestadoconvocatoria())->getEstado() . '" disabled>';
}
else
{
echo '<input type="text" name="txtEstado" id="txtEstado" disabled>';
}
?>
</td>
</tr>
</tbody>
</table>
<script language="javascript">
function listar() {
history.back();
}
</script>
<form method="post" name="frmConvocatoria" id="frmConvocatoria" action="<?php echo $actual_link?>">
<?php
if($lang=='en' || $lang=='en_GB')
{
echo '<input type="button" id="btnVolver" name="btnVolver" value="Back" onClick="listar();">';
}
else
{
echo '<input type="button" id="btnVolver" name="btnVolver" value="Volver" onClick="listar();">';
}
if(isset($data) && is_object($data))
{
if(isset($idCandidatoWP) && $idCandidatoWP!=null && is_numeric($idCandidatoWP) && ($data->getCodigoestadoconvocatoria())->getIdestadoconvocatoria()==CODIGO_ESTADO_ABIERTA)
{
if($lang=='en' || $lang=='en_GB')
{
echo '<input type="submit" id="btnInscribirse" name="accionConvocatoria" value="Register" class="margenes_laterales_4">';
}
else
{
echo '<input type="submit" id="btnInscribirse" name="accionConvocatoria" value="Inscribirse" class="margenes_laterales_4">';
}
}
else if((!isset($idCandidatoWP) || $idCandidatoWP==null) && ($data->getCodigoestadoconvocatoria())->getIdestadoconvocatoria()==CODIGO_ESTADO_ABIERTA)
{
if($lang=='en' || $lang=='en_GB')
{
echo '<div class="fondo_color" style="margin-top:1.5em;"><span>You must <a href="' . $root . 'en/login-2/' . '" target="_self"><u>login</u></a> or <a href="' . $root . '" target="_self"><u>register</u></a> before apply any of our calls</span></div>';
}
else
{
echo '<div class="fondo_color" style="margin-top:1.5em;"><span>Si deseas inscribirte en alguna de nuestras convocatorias, debes <a href="' . $root . 'es/login/' . '" target="_self"><u>iniciar sesión</u></a>
o <a href="' . $root . 'es/register/' . '" target="_self"><u>registrarte</u></a></span></div>';
}
}
}
?>
</form>
</div>
</body>
</html>